Restaurant Anmol is located in Los Cristianos in Tenerife.

Edificio Parque Magarita, Calle Bosten, Locale 77b, Los Cristianos

Anmol Restaurant is located in Los Cristianos which is a popular holiday resort in the south of Tenerife. If you are looking for an Indian restaurant during your stay in this area, try Anmol Restaurant.

Tenerife Travel Guide | Restaurants in Tenerife

Leave a Reply

Your email address will not be published.